    • A Profound Work of History

      Bijan Omrani is the offspring of a marriage between an Iranian nobleman and and an Englishwoman from a military family. Omrani is explcitly English, a Christion and a churchwarden. He has taught at Eton. His thesis is that Christianity produced England as we know it. If Christianity is now withering on the bough, it ought to be of great concern. For over 1,700 years Christianity was instrumental in the creation and development of the English nation, its law codes and morality., its system of government and monarchy. Its cultural impact is profound, from art to landscape. Its influence, Omrani contends, has been enormous, profound and largely benign. It shoudl not be lightly abandoned. Omrani writes history as literature; anyone can enjoy, as well as being instructed by, this book.
